Importing the JD Edwards Application Pack OPAR
This section describes the procedure to set up the software library, and then import and deploy the JD Edwards Application OPAR into Oracle Enterprise Manager Cloud Control and to the Management Agent.
To import the JD Edwards Application Pack OPAR, use the following sequence of line commands:
Change to the
oms/bin
directory of your Cloud Control installation. For example:cd /u01/app/emgc13/oms/bin/
Enter this command to set up the import of the JD Edwards EnterpriseOne Application Pack into Cloud Control:
./emcli setup -url=https://denlx01:7799/em -username=sysman -password=Oracle123 -trustall
Verify the console display indicates the command was successful as shown in this example:
Oracle Enterprise Manager Cloud Control 13c Release 1 (13.1.0.0.0.) Copyright (c) 1996, 2015 Oracle Corporation and/or its affiliates. All rights reserved. Emcli setup successful
Run this command to perform the import of the JD Edwards EnterpriseOne Application Pack OPAR into Cloud Control:
./emcli import_update -file=/u01/app/AddOnDevKitWork/jde_plugin/plugin_opar/13.1.1.1.0_oracle.apps.jded_2000_0.opar -omslocal
Verify the console display indicates the command was successful as shown in this example:
Processing update: Plug-in - Oracle Jdedwards EnterpriseOne Plugin consists of monitoring and management for Oracle Jdedwards EnterpriseOne system. Operation completed successfully. Update has been uploaded to Enterprise Manager. Please use the Self Update Home to manage this update.
At this point the import of the JD Edwards EnterpriseOne Application Pack OPAR into Cloud Control is complete.
